More than eight in ten (83%) members of the public say they view charities and the work they do as either more important than ever or becoming increasingly important, according to new research from Enthuse, the donations, fundraising and event registration platform. This is comprised of over a third (35%) believing the role of charities in society is more important than it’s ever been and nearly half (48%) seeing it as increasingly important. The annual Donor Pulse report explores the public’s giving habits, how they feel about the work charities do and trust levels in good causes. The Access Group, one of the largest UK-headquartered business software providers serving over 160,000 organisations globally, today announced it has reached an agreement to acquire Enthuse, a fundraising, donations and events registration technology provider. The partnership adds peer-to-peer fundraising and events expertise to the Access charity software proposition, offering solutions that enable organisations to maximise their fundraising impact under their own brand identity. Enthuse are delighted to be named the official fundraising platform of the Baxters Loch Ness Marathon & Festival of Running. The eight-year partnership begins immediately ahead of the 2026 event on Sunday 27 September, and runs until 2034. The announcement is the latest addition to Enthuse’s partnership portfolio, with our platform already being the official partner of 70% of the top 10 fundraising mass participation events in the UK. Four out of five (79%) members of the public say they view charities and the work they do as either very important or essential, according to new research from Enthuse, the donations, fundraising and event registration platform. The seventeenth edition of the Donor Pulse report explores how the public feels about the work charities do, their giving habits and their level of trust in good causes compared to other British institutions.
